Distance From Sumburgh Airport to Diori Hamani International Airport, LSI - NIM Distance

The distance from Sumburgh Airport (LSI) to Diori Hamani International Airport (NIM) is 3211 miles or 5167 kilometers or 2789 nautical miles.

How long does it take to travel from Lerwick ( United Kingdom ) to Niamey ( Niger )?

A one-way nonstop (direct) flight between Lerwick and Niamey takes around 7 hours 22 minutes.
Estimated flight time from Sumburgh Airport, Lerwick, United Kingdom to Diori Hamani International Airport, Niamey, Niger is 7 hours 22 minutes under avarage conditions. Your actual flying time may vary depending on wind direction/speed or weather conditions. This calculation does not include the departure and landing times of the aircraft. In addition, it does not cover the person identity check, ticket check-in and baggage collection times at the airport.

Why should you arrive 3 hours before international flight? Flyers who are traveling to an international destination should arrive at the airport earlier than domestic flyers. This is because international flights can have additional check-in requirements, like passport verification, that need to be completed before you receive your boarding pass.
